Two legs vs. three legs

In general, neither system has a clear edge over the other; each has benefits and downsides. Two-legged work platforms often have a lower overall footprint, more significant space for pedal motion, and a little bit more strength under load. On the other side, they are far less sturdy when empty and aren’t the best option for sloped or rough surfaces; in these situations, three-legged stands are much more suitable. These enable the bike to rotate 360 degrees and adapt better to the floor, thanks to a center.

 

The link between the legs and the center column, which isn’t usually stable enough and can cause the stand to bend under heavy loads, is the only problem area of three-legged variants. The space between the pedals and the central column may become constrained in particular circumstances. In general, we advise a two-legged stand for use in the home workplace and a three-legged model for use in mobile environments and on rough ground.

The first step is to determine the tire pressure that your Pedego Electric Bike needs. This will depend on the size and type of tires on your electric bike, as well as the terrain you plan to ride on. Generally speaking, the tires on a Pedego Electric Bike should be inflated to between 40 and 60 PSI.

If you don’t have a gauge to measure the pressure of your tires, you can check the sidewall of the tire. The manufacturer should list the recommended tire pressure there. For example, a tire marked “max 60 psi” should be inflated to that pressure. You can also check your Pedego Electric Bike owner’s manual for the correct tire pressure. If you don’t have an owner’s manual, you can call the Pedego customer service department for assistance.

Once you’ve determined the correct tire pressure for your Pedego Electric Bike, it’s important to make sure your tires are properly inflated. An under-inflated tire can cause a dangerous situation, leading to a blowout or other failure. On the other hand, an over-inflated tire can cause uncomfortable rides, decreased traction, and increased wear on the tire.
